# Hey on-call — this env file drives the Quistrel validator plugin loader.
# Plugins register themselves under /opt/quistrel/validators and get sandboxed
# before any payroll-grade data touches them. If a plugin misbehaves, flip
# QUISTREL_PLUGIN_STRICT=1 and restart the worker; don't just kill the pod.
# Schema checks run first, custom validators second. The registry won't hand
# out plugin manifests without authentication, so the loader needs a signing
# token at boot. The next line sets that token.

secret setting of fahap-yajef: COURIER_KEY3=eaf

Step 4: Recalibrating for Sensor Drift — Verdanta Controller 3.x

Plugin authors must migrate to the new drift-compensation hooks. The legacy polling interface no longer applies smoothing, so raw humidity readings will wander over long sessions. Register your calibration callback before the controller's warm-up phase completes. Your plugin manifest must declare the compensation profile it expects; the reference values are shown below.

service settings:
novath:
  pin: 1396
  tenant: pelys
  seal: seal_ccc035e1
  metrics_host: metrics.novath.qorvelworks.test
  standby_team: fraeth
  escalation: drueth-zorok
  nonce: 61d508

Subject: String extraction script now part of release prep

Team, quick note ahead of the weekly sync. The Lexhaven extraction script now pulls translation strings from all Quillmark modules automatically, so manual exports are no longer needed. Run it before cutting any release branch; it fails loudly on untagged strings. Marta verified it against the Norwind locale bundle last week. The build it was validated against is below.

build token for yajof-bajof: htk31_506ff1188f74596b5bb2eec94edc43c

## PedalShift Build Provenance

PedalShift is the rebalancing tool for the Corvane bike-share fleet. Plugin authors must build against signed artifacts only. Unsigned builds are rejected at load time. Each release is produced by the Ostermill pipeline, which stamps a provenance record into the manifest. Do not repackage or strip metadata; downstream verification will fail. To confirm you are targeting the correct artifact, check the token printed below.

pipeline stamp: htk31_f769b577b3028a4e9958e5bb8d1259a